Tennessee Healthy Hardwoods
 




Saturday, March 31, 2012
7:00 am



The half-day programs will begin with registration opening at 7 a.m. (local time). Following some opening remarks, attendees will be treated to two sessions taught by the University of Tennessee Extension Forester and the FRREC Center Director: the importance of forested watersheds, keeping forest waters clean, and a short field tour prior to a sponsored luncheon.

The event schedule is as follows:

March 24 - Cherokee National Forest in Unicoi County (Unicoi);
Register by March 21

March 31 - UT Forest Resources AgResearch and Education Center in Anderson County (Oak Ridge);
Register by March 28

April 21 - Chickasaw State Forest in Chester County (Henderson);
Register by April 18

April 28 - Lewis State Forest in Lewis County (Hohenwald);
Register by April 25
